What is Surinamese Dollar (SRD)

The Surinamese dollar (SRD) is the official currency of Suriname, a small country located on the northeastern coast of South America. It was introduced in 2004, replacing the earlier Surinamese guilder at a rate of 1 dollar = 1,000 guilders. The SRD is denoted by the symbol “$” or sometimes “SRD$” to distinguish it from other dollar-denominated currencies.

The currency is issued by the Central Bank of Suriname and is divided into 100 cents. Banknotes come in various denominations; commonly used notes include 2.50, 5, 10, 20, 50, 100, 200, and 500 SRD. Coins are available in 1, 5, 10, 25, and 50 cents, as well as 1, 2.5, 5, and 10 SRD.

The value of the SRD has been subject to fluctuations, particularly due to political and economic changes in the country. Many Surinamese residents turn to foreign currencies, such as the U.S. dollar, to safeguard their savings. As a result, when converting from SRD to other currencies, including the Neth Antilles Guilder (ANG), the exchange rates can vary widely.

What is Neth Antilles Guilder (ANG)

The Neth Antilles Guilder (ANG) was the official currency of the Netherlands Antilles, a group of Caribbean islands that included Aruba, Curacao, Bonaire, Sint Eustatius, Saba, and Sint Maarten. Although the Netherlands Antilles was dissolved in 2010, the ANG remains the currency of Curacao and Sint Maarten. The symbol for the ANG is “ƒ” or “NAF,” and it is subdivided into 100 cents.

The Neth Antilles Guilder is managed by the Central Bank of Curacao and Sint Maarten, which oversees monetary policy and issues currency notes and coins. Banknotes are issued in denominations of 10, 20, 50, 100, and 250 guilder, while coins are available in 1, 5, 10, 25 cents, and 1 and 2.5 guilder.

Historically, the ANG was pegged to the U.S. dollar at a fixed rate, which provided stability against fluctuations in the foreign exchange market. However, changes in the global economy and local market conditions may affect its value.
